How do you calculate the rise and run to find the slope of a line?​

Respuesta :

rywnxiong rywnxiong
  • 02-11-2021

Divide the change in y over the change in x

if you have 2 points (a,b) and (c,d) it's

slope= (b-d)/(a-c)
